Commissioners approve $200,000 port sales‑tax release for WWCC Farm to Fork expansion
Summary
The board voted 3–0 to release $200,000 from the Port of Walla Walla’s economic development sales‑tax fund to Walla Walla Community College for a Farm to Fork facility expansion, a project commissioners described as an instructional and agritourism investment.
The Walla Walla County Board of Commissioners voted unanimously Jan. 5 to release $200,000 from the port’s economic development sales‑tax fund to Walla Walla Community College for the college’s Farm to Fork Facility Expansion Project.
